26 - Hourly In-School Supervision Coordinator
Qualifications
- High School Diploma or GED
- Previous experience working with young adults
- Must be 21 years of age or older at the time of hire
- Demonstrated proficiency in Microsoft Office
- Demonstrated ability to communicate effectively
- Demonstrated ability to maintain records and prepare standard reports
- Demonstrated good telephone skills
- Demonstrated ability to maintain strict confidentiality in all aspects of assignments
- Demonstrated ability and willingness to work with high school level students with minor discipline problems
- Demonstrated organizational ability and effective time management
- Preferred: College course work in education or related field
